Daniel Sandana is a Principal Materials and Corrosion Engineer working for the ROSEN Integrity Services division in Newcastle upon Tyne, UK. He holds a PhD a MSc in Materials Science and Engineering from ESIREM in France, and a PhD in SCC of pipeline steels from Newcastle University in the UK. He is a European Chartered Engineer (Eur Ing) and a AMPP certified Senior Corrosion Technologist. Daniel has over 17 years’ experience in Asset Integrity Management within the Oil & Gas upstream and transmission markets worldwide. A large part of his experience resides in ensuring assurance of operational integrity of ageing process plants and pipelines, and providing Materials & Corrosion consultancy for front-end-engineering and design projects. His current interests include the integrity management and repurposing of pipelines for emerging fuels including hydrogen and CO2. He has published more than 25 technical papers in peer-reviewed events and journals, including papers on the topic of hydrogen and CO2 transportation. His paper “Safe repurposing of vintage pipelines for hydrogen in North America, IPC 2022-87088” was nominated for best paper at IPC 2022.
